What is La Liga?
La Liga, officially known as La Liga EA Sports for sponsorship reasons, is the highest division of the Spanish football league system. It features 20 teams competing in a double round-robin format, with each club playing 38 matches per season. The league is famous for legendary clubs such as:

Understanding the La Liga Standings
The La Liga table is updated after every matchday and reflects the performance of each club throughout the season. Here’s how the standings work:
Key Metrics in La Liga Standings:
- Points (PTS): 3 for a win, 1 for a draw, 0 for a loss.
- Goal Difference (GD): Goals scored minus goals conceded.
- Goals Scored (GF) and Goals Against (GA): Important for tie-breaks.
- Wins, Draws, Losses: Helps determine recent form.
Importance of the Standings
- Top 4 Teams: Qualify for the UEFA Champions League.
- 5th and 6th Place: Enter the Europa League or Conference League.
- Bottom 3 Teams: Face relegation to the second division (La Liga 2).

Top Teams and Rivalries in La Liga
While La Liga is filled with exciting matches, certain rivalries stand out due to history and intensity:
1. El Clásico – Real Madrid vs. Barcelona
One of the biggest fixtures in world football, El Clásico is watched by millions around the globe.
2. Madrid Derby – Real Madrid vs. Atlético Madrid
A high-stakes city rivalry packed with drama and passion.
3. Seville Derby – Sevilla vs. Real Betis
One of the most underrated but fiery rivalries in European football.
4. Basque Derby – Athletic Bilbao vs. Real Sociedad
A regional rivalry full of tradition and talent.
